Cigarettes owe their origins to American Indians, who were the first to wrap tobacco in the straw, cane and corn leaves. After the appearance in Europe for nearly 250 years, the only means of obtaining pleasure from tobacco were pipes and cigars.
In 1913, the company has released RJReynolds Camel cigarettes. In the pack was portrayed camel Ol'Joe, speaking in well-known in those days the circus Barnum & Bailey Circus. By the end of World War I half of smokers have preferred Camel cigarettes.

In most parts of the state, Californians appear to be kicking the cigarettes habit.Last year, 11.9% of Californians said they smoked, down one percentage point from 2009. California has the second-lowest smoking cigarettes rate in the country, according to recent reports from the California Department of Public Health and CDC. Utah, where 9.1% of residents are smokers, has the lowest rate.Another recent report paints a picture of a different kind of cheap cigarettes habit in Sacramento. When apartment tenants light up a cigarette, it's not just their smoking cigarettes-averse neighbors who suffer. Landlords are also sucking it up — in increased cleaning costs. But by implementing complete smoke-free rules throughout their properties, owners of California multi-unit rental buildings could save up to $18 million a year statewide on the cost of cleaning apartments vacated by tenants who smoke, according to a new UCLA study.
